Materials Needed:
- Worsted weight acrylic yarn (multicolor blend recommended)
- 5 mm crochet hook
Front and Back Panels:
Chain and Start Rows:
- Chain 70 (you can adjust for a looser fit).
- Additional chain of three for height.
- Work treble crochets into each chain stitch.
Row Completion:
- At the end of each row, chain three to maintain height.
- Continue with treble crochets for 15-20 rows or until the panel reaches desired length.
Collar/Shoulder Portion:
- Chain three for each collar side.
- Work treble crochets for shoulder portions with varying stitch counts to create an off-center neck hole.
Connect Front and Back Panels:
- Slip stitch or sew the shoulder portions of both panels securely.
Sleeves:
Sleeve Openings:
- Attach yarn at the bottom corner of the panels.
- Work treble crochets around each sleeve opening, placing two treble crochets in each row stitch.
Sleeve Construction:
- Continue with rows of treble crochets, slip stitching at the end of each row.
- Make adjustments in sleeve length as needed to ensure a comfortable fit.
Repeat for Second Sleeve:
- Repeat the same process for the second sleeve, adjusting length if necessary.
Finishing Touches:
- Weave in loose ends and turn the pullover right side out for a cleaner seam appearance.
